Surviving British Red Cross records tell us that between August
1914 and November 1918, the ladies of Sussex 54 VAD nursed a total of 958 soldier patients at Hickwells and Beechlands. That means that Nurse Oliver’s album represents less than 14 per cent of admissions although of course, she would have had a hand in nursing the majority of the
men who passed through the two hospitals.
One hundred and twenty nine sick and
wounded soldiers left their marks in Edith Oliver's album. They, and a handful of soldiers from another
album kept by Nurse Rose Beatrice Smythe (indicated by an asterisk) are recorded below.
Men highlighted in bold were killed in action or died as a result of
wounds or sickness. Where PHOTOS or SERVICE RECORDS survive, these have been highlighted.

Names in italics are those of a further 33 men who spent time at either of the two hospitals and are mentioned
in contemporary sources. Regimental details, where stated, are those noted at
the time the men were at Hickwells or Beechlands.
